The ingredients needed to cook Khaman dhokla:
  1. Get 500 grams Gram flour
  2. Take Coriander leaves for garnishing
  3. Prepare Salt as per taste
  4. Get 2 pinch Asafoetida
  5. Use 4 pinch Mustard Seeds
  6. You need 8-10 Curry leaves
  7. Prepare 2 tsp Baking soda
  8. Take 4-5 Green chillies
  9. Use 2 tsp Citric acid
  10. Take Ginger finely chopped
  11. Take 1 tbsp Powdered sugar
  12. Prepare 3 tsp Sugar for tempering
  13. Use 1 tbsp Oil for tempering
  14. Take 2 tsp Oil for batter
Instructions to make Khaman dhokla:
  1. To make khaman dhokla, first of all strain the gram flour into a big bowl with a strainer so that the thick granules will get left behind and you'll get a smooth and fluffy batter. - Now add salt, citric acid (lemon juice), finely chopped ginger and finely chopped green chillies.
  2. Then add powdered sugar and 2 pinch asafoetida into the bowl. - Mix all this ingredients properly and then add little water step by step and make a thick batter with it. Don't add the water directly otherwise it will create lumps in your batter. Add it little step by step and mix it with a spoon.
  3. Whisk it in one direction with your hand for atleast 10 to 15 minutes. - Add 2 tsp oil and mix well. - This work of whisking is the only hard work you have to do for making the dhokla. - After whisking it continuously for 10 minutes, keep it for rest for at least 25 to 30 minutes.
  4. After 30 minutes of complete rest add 2 tsp baking soda into it and whisk it again thoroughly only for seconds. - Now without wasting any time add this batter into a container in which you want to make your dhokla.
  5. Take a big bowl and boil some water in it. - Make sure that it can sustain your container. - Put a stand into the bowl. - Now put this container over the stand. - Put the gas on medium flame and cover the lid gently.
  6. Cook it for at least 20 to 25 minutes at medium flame. - After getting 25 minutes put off the gas flame and let it rest for 5 minutes. - Don't open the lid for five minutes and it will give you more better result.
  7. Now your dhokla is ready but it is incomplete without a tempering (tadka) over it. - So for making a tempering heat 1 tbsp of oil in a pan. - Add mustard seeds and let it crackle. - Add some slit green chillies, curry leaves - Add 1 cup of water into it. It will produce some sizzling sound.
  8. Now after adding water add some sugar and 2 tsp of lemon juice. - Put off the gas flame and let it get lukewarm. - Add this lukewarm tempering over your dhokla and enjoy your day. - Your dhokla is ready. garnish it with some finely chopped fresh leaves and some type of dips and chutneys.
